Total Estimated Time for the Entire Escape Room Visit

Considering check-in, pre-game instructions, and post-game debriefing, the entire escape room experience lasts approximately 90 minutes.

Stage of the Experience Estimated Time
Arrival & Check-In 10-15 minutes
Pre-Game Instructions 5-10 minutes
Escape Room Gameplay 60 minutes
Post-Game Debriefing 5-15 minutes
Total Time Commitment 90 minutes

This means that even though the game itself is 60 minutes long, you should plan for at least an hour and a half for the full experience.

Q: Can we finish an escape room faster than the 60-minute limit?

A: Yes! Some teams escape in 45-50 minutes, especially if they’re experienced or use hints effectively. However, if you need more time, you can play until the 60-minute limit.

Q: How early should we arrive before our escape room starts?

A: It’s recommended to arrive 10-15 minutes early to complete check-in, sign waivers, and hear the game instructions.

Q: Do escape rooms have time extensions if we don’t finish in time?

A: Most escape rooms, including Mission Escape Games, do not extend the time. However, you can always ask the game master for a walkthrough if you want to see how the game ends.
